Overview of GE IC693MDL753
The GE IC693MDL753 is a discrete output module from the Series 90-30 Programmable Logic Controller (PLC) family. Formerly manufactured by GE Fanuc and now part of Emerson Automation, this module provides 32 output channels, grouped into 4 sets of 8 channels each. Designed to work seamlessly with GE Fanuc 90-30 PLCs, the IC693MDL753 supports a wide voltage range, offering excellent performance for industrial control applications. It ensures high reliability and accurate control, ideal for various automation systems.

GE IC693MDL753 Technical Specifications
| Specification | Details |
|---|---|
| Part Number | IC693MDL753 |
| Manufacturer | GE Fanuc (now Emerson Automation) |
| Product Type | Discrete Output Module |
| Product Line | Series 90-30 |
| Output Channels | 32 discrete output channels |
| Output Groups | 4 groups, 8 channels per group |
| Nominal Output Voltage | 12–24 VDC |
| Output Voltage Range | 10.2–28.8 VDC |
| Output Current per Point | 0.5A |
| Output Current per Group | 4A |
| Max Current per Common Pin | 3A |
| Module Current Draw | 260 mA from 5VDC backplane |
| Inrush Current | 5.4A for 20 ms |
| Isolation | 1500V (field to logic side) |
| Power Consumption | 260 mA (from 5VDC backplane) |
| Response Time | 0.5 ms for both ON and OFF transitions |
| Leakage Current (OFF state) | 0.1 mA |
Description of GE IC693MDL753
The GE IC693MDL753 is an essential discrete output module designed for use with GE Fanuc 90-30 PLCs. It offers 32 output channels, distributed in 4 groups of 8, providing flexible and reliable control over multiple electrical devices. The output voltage range for the module spans from 10.2V to 28.8V DC, with nominal voltage settings of 12V to 24V DC.
Each channel provides an output current of 0.5 Amperes, with the module capable of delivering up to 4 Amperes per group. The maximum current for each common pin is 3 Amperes. The IC693MDL753 also ensures smooth signal transitions with a fast response time of 0.5 ms, ideal for applications requiring quick control operations.
Notably, the IC693MDL753 supports excellent isolation features, with 1500V isolation between the field side and logic side, and 250V isolation between output groups. Additionally, the module generates an inrush current of 5.4 Amperes for 20 milliseconds, which is typical for switching devices like motors or large electrical loads.
The module is compatible with both local I/O and distributed I/O configurations. It can be installed in any available I/O slot within the Series 90-30 chassis, excluding slots reserved for the CPU or communication adapters. Its field-installable design makes it easy to integrate into existing systems, and it occupies just a single slot within the rack.
For wiring electrical loads, it is recommended to use the IC693CBL315 cable assembly.
Applications of GE IC693MDL753
- Automation Systems: Controls discrete outputs for industrial automation processes.
- Control of Motors and Valves: Ideal for switching motor drives, solenoids, or valves.
- Machine Control: Used in systems requiring fast and reliable digital output control.
- Manufacturing Lines: Suited for operations that require multiple, isolated discrete output channels.
